Trump safe after gunfire at Washington event, AP reports




US President Donald Trump was reported "uninjured" after shots were fired during the White House Correspondents’ Association dinner at the Washington Hilton, according to Associated Press.

A law enforcement official said a shooter opened fire, prompting an immediate evacuation.

The report said that guests ducked for cover as US Secret Service and security personnel rushed into the hall.

Multiple witnesses reported hearing several shots, while authorities secured the venue and deployed additional forces, including the National Guard.
